Choosing the Right Polythene Wrap for Your Needs

Selecting the ideal polythene wrap is more than a glance . Different uses require varying thicknesses and characteristics . For example if you're shielding belongings from grime , a thinner gauge will often suffice. However, when transporting fragile items or guarding against moisture , a stronger grade of wrap is crucial . Consider factors like visibility, tear strength , and fading protection to ensure you're getting the optimal option for your particular requirements | purpose.

Green Options in Polythene Wrapping

The growing concern around polyethylene waste has spurred development in wrapping alternatives. While conventional polythene wrapping poses problems for the environment, various sustainable possibilities are available. These include bio-based plastic films, which utilize resources like potato starch for a reduced carbon footprint. Furthermore, recyclable polythene options, designed for improved recovery, are receiving traction. Factors for choosing these replacements should consider cost, efficiency, and accessibility.
